3 CREDITS This is a special topic tribal studies course, which focuses on the motion picture industry role in the institutionalization of stereotyping and racism of Indian people in the United States. It is a factual, rather than judgmental approach. The course will present films from the silent era to the present. Course work will concentrate on student responses and analysis to films as well as group projects to allow students to follow their own interests in dealing with the issues of the course.
